Chemical Property Profile of (6-fluoro-2-methyl-3,4-dihydro-2H-quinolin-1-yl)-(4-iodo-1-methylpyrazol-3-yl)methanone
Property Insights of (6-fluoro-2-methyl-3,4-dihydro-2H-quinolin-1-yl)-(4-iodo-1-methylpyrazol-3-yl)methanone
The XLogP value of 3.1453 indicates that (6-fluoro-2-methyl-3,4-dihydro-2H-quinolin-1-yl)-(4-iodo-1-methylpyrazol-3-yl)methanone is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 38.13 Ų, (6-fluoro-2-methyl-3,4-dihydro-2H-quinolin-1-yl)-(4-iodo-1-methylpyrazol-3-yl)methanone ex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, (6-fluoro-2-methyl-3,4-dihydro-2H-quinolin-1-yl)-(4-iodo-1-methylpyrazol-3-yl)methanone has 0 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
